Core Themes in the Book
1. Understanding the Nature of Doubt
The book explores doubt as a learned mental pattern rather than a permanent flaw. By understanding how doubt forms and operates, readers gain the ability to recognise it without being controlled by it.
2. Identifying and Challenging Negative Thought Patterns
A central theme is the importance of becoming aware of self-limiting beliefs and habitual negative thinking. The book guides readers in questioning the accuracy of these thoughts and replacing them with healthier, more balanced perspectives.
3. Action as the Foundation of Confidence
Confidence is presented not as a personality trait, but as a result of consistent action. The book emphasises that taking small, intentional steps—despite doubt—is key to building self-trust and momentum.
4. Self-Compassion Over Self-Criticism
Rather than harsh self-judgment, the book promotes self-compassion as a powerful tool for growth. Treating oneself with kindness during moments of uncertainty reduces fear, strengthens resilience, and weakens the grip of doubt.
5. Mindfulness and Awareness
Mindfulness is used to help readers observe doubt without becoming overwhelmed by it. By developing present-moment awareness, individuals learn to respond thoughtfully instead of reacting emotionally.
6. Focusing on Strengths and Past Achievements
The book encourages readers to reconnect with their successes and positive qualities. Recognising past achievements provides concrete evidence that challenges self-doubt and reinforces confidence.
7. Realistic Goal-Setting
Setting achievable, meaningful goals is presented as a practical way to counter doubt. Progress—no matter how small—builds motivation, clarity, and a sense of capability.
8. The Power of Supportive Environments
The influence of relationships and environment is a recurring theme. Surrounding oneself with supportive, affirming people helps reinforce confidence and counters internal negativity.
9. Reframing Doubt as a Growth Signal
Rather than eliminating doubt entirely, the book reframes it as information—an indicator of growth, change, or learning. This shift allows doubt to become a guide rather than an obstacle.
10. Personal Agency and Self-Trust
At its heart, the book is about reclaiming agency. Readers are encouraged to trust themselves, make decisions with clarity, and live in alignment with their values—free from the constant pull of hesitation.
